    Fewer than 70 athletes are known to have played in both Major League Baseball (MLB) [a] and the National Football League (NFL). This includes two Heisman Trophy winners (Vic Janowicz and Bo Jackson) [1] and seven members of the Pro Football Hall of Fame (Red Badgro, [2] Paddy Driscoll, [3] George Halas, [4] Ernie Nevers, [5] Ace Parker, [6] Jim Thorpe, [7] and Deion Sanders).     Stats at Pro Football Reference Alexander Leatherwood (born January 5, 1999) is an American professional football offensive tackle . He played college football at Alabama , where he was two-time CFP national champion and the winner of the Outland and Jacobs Blocking trophies in 2020.

    Moody played college football at Alabama from 2018 to 2022. [1] Alabama won the national championship in 2020. [2] He did not start any games until his senior season in 2022. [1] In 2022, he played in 10 games, starting eight, totaling 50 tackles, two sacks and one fumble recovery. [1] [3] Moody missed time due to injury in 2022. [4] [5]

    Stats at Pro Football Reference John Kimball Scott III (born October 30, 1995) is an American professional football punter for the Los Angeles Chargers of the National Football League (NFL). He played college football at Alabama , and was selected by the Green Bay Packers in the fifth round of the 2018 NFL draft .
